Summary
For Sale via Online Unconditional Auction - Positioned just moments from the heart of the ever-popular St Johns Village and a picturesque stretch of the Basingstoke Canal, this charming ground floor apartment offers beautifully presented accommodation in a highly convenient and sought-after setting. Combining character with contemporary styling, the property is ideally suited to first-time buyers, downsizers or investors alike.
The apartment has a bright and welcoming atmosphere. A particular feature is the contemporary kitchen, finished with sleek high gloss units, integrated appliances including an external extractor, together with tiled splashbacks and flooring for a stylish and practical finish. Double glazing further enhances the comfort and efficiency of the home.
The well-proportioned accommodation enjoys an excellent sense of light and space, whilst outside residents can enjoy a communal lawned garden, ideal for relaxing during the warmer months. The property also benefits from private parking, adding further appeal and practicality.
Situated within easy reach of the local shops, cafs and restaurants of St John's Village, the apartment enjoys a highly convenient setting that blends village charm with excellent connectivity. St John's itself offers a welcoming community feel with its village green and the scenic Basingstoke Canal, providing attractive waterside walks right on the doorstep. The property is also ideally positioned for leisurely canal-side walks leading directly into Woking Town Centre, where a vibrant and cosmopolitan lifestyle awaits. Woking offers an extensive selection of bars, cafs, restaurants and shops, alongside the Peacocks Centre, home to the New Victoria Theatre, a multi-screen cinema and further retail amenities. For commuters, Woking's highly regarded mainline station provides fast and frequent services to London Waterloo in approximately 23 minutes, while nearby Brookwood station offers further convenient access to London in around 30 minutes, making this an exceptionally well-connected and desirable location.
